Hotel Stella Maris Capoliveri

Hotel Stella Maris Capoliveri Address: Localita Pareti, Pareti, Italy

Minimum price found for Hotel Stella Maris Capoliveri was: Null EUR

Click here to get more information, photos & guest ratings for Hotel Stella Maris Capoliveri